Electric toothbrush.
The rechargeable battery died on my electric toothbrush - after a few
minutes looking at prices online, I reached for the Dremel! A 4x AAA battery holder and some hot melt glue, and its working again, the difficulty arises from the 4x 1/3 AA battery assembly was as if a core to the pick up coil for the no leads charging stand. Unfortunately I neglected to refit the scrap battery, so the pick up coil no longer has a big fat shorted turn in the middle of it - when I stood it in the charging stand, the charge LED looked a bit over-bright. I could just take out the AAA cells and put them in a regular charger, but I kind of like the convenience of the charging stand. How bad can it be?! Thanks for any advice. |
